Twitter Acquires Design Firm Ueno, Adding About 50 Employees

Twitter Inc. acquired design agency Ueno, adding the firm’s nearly 50 employees to improve the quality of its social-media service and speed the rollout of new products.
Ueno, which has offices in San Francisco, Los Angeles, New York and Reykjavik, Iceland, lists Alphabet Inc.’s Google, Facebook Inc. and Uber Technologies Inc. among its clients. Twitter was also a Ueno client and a company spokesman said the firm will wrap up existing projects before closing the agency entirely. Terms of the transaction weren’t disclosed.
